A new Ning community is hoping to shake things up.
Shaker Recruitment Advertising & Communications recently launched a company blog at http://shakerrecruitment.ning.com. The community will be a place where agency thought leaders can share their ideas, engage in conversation and invite participation of all parties interested in recruitment and retention communication strategies.
“We’re pleased to have our blog up and running to provide access to our team of experts and their perspectives,” Vice President Joe Shaker, Jr. said. “We believe in the power of social media providing an open platform for communication, participation and conversation among colleagues and clients and anyone interested in the most relevant recruitment/retention topics of the day.”
The blog, like most Ning communities, has a section for members to create their own page, as well as sections for members, blogs, events, videos and photos.
“The Ning platform has proven to be a worthy and flexible environment for us to establish a branded presence where we can invite participation – in essence, connect within a community – to broaden the conversation, elevate ideas, and hopefully generate value through the collective sharing,” Kris Penn, director of creative services at Shaker, said. “This is a welcome way for us to show what it means to truly live our brand: we connect.”
Shaker Recruitment Advertising & Communications helps organizations realize their business objectives by connecting them with top talent through employer branding, employee and candidate communications, interactive media, campaign development, collateral and metrics.
Shaker strategizes and manages recruitment and retention communications – from research and planning to design and development to placement and measurement – to foster employee engagement.
